精品文档---下载后可任意编辑一种基于可重构的路由协议的设计与实现的开题报告一、选题背景在现代通信网络中,路由协议是非常重要的一个组成部分。路由协议主要负责决定数据包在网络中的传输路径,避开数据包丢失、延迟、重复等问题。目前主流的路由协议有 OSPF、BGP、RIP 等。这些路由协议已经被广泛应用在互联网和企业内部网络中,取得了很好的效果。但是,在一些特别的应用场景下,这些传统的路由协议存在一些问题:1. 灵活性不足。传统路由协议通常是预定好的,难以进行扩展和修改。如需修改需要重新设计协议,这样就极大限制了协议的灵活性和可扩展性。2. 性能受限。随着网络规模的增加,传统的路由协议容易出现性能瓶颈。在大规模网络中,路由器需要维护的路由表和协议信息会变得非常庞大,导致路由器处理速度变慢,延迟增大。为解决这些问题,讨论人员提出了一种基于可重构的路由协议设计。通过可重构的路由协议,可以在不重构硬件的情况下修改路由协议,提高路由协议的灵活性和可扩展性。此外,可重构路由器的多核架构和高性能硬件资源也可以提高路由器的运行性能。二、讨论目标本课题旨在讨论可重构的路由协议设计,并实现一个基于可重构路由器的路由协议系统。具体目标包括:1. 讨论现有的基于可重构的路由协议设计方案,了解其原理和性能。2. 分析路由协议的重要特性和性能指标,如路由计算时间、路由表大小、收敛时间等。3. 设计一种基于可重构的路由协议,并实现在可重构路由器上。4. 在模拟器上对基于可重构路由器实现的路由协议进行性能测试,并与现有的路由协议进行对比。5. 验证基于可重构路由器的路由协议的灵活性和可扩展性。三、讨论内容本课题的讨论内容主要包括以下方面的工作:精品文档---下载后可任意编辑1. 讨论基于可重构路由器的硬件架构和编程模型,了解可重构路由器的工作原理和编程方法。2. 讨论现有的可重构路由协议设计方案,了解其实现细节和优缺点。重点讨论如何在可重构路由器上实现常见的路由协议,如 OSPF、BGP 等,并分析其性能。3. 设计一种基于可重构的路由协议,针对可重构路由器的硬件架构进行优化,并实现在可重构路由器上。设计过程应考虑路由协议的拓扑发现、路由计算、路径选择、路由表更新等核心功能。4. 使用模拟器对基于可重构路由器实现的路由协议进行性能测试,包括路由计算时间、收敛时间、路由表大小等。同时,与现有路由协议进行对比,评估优劣。5. 验证基于可重构路由器的...